Hi Savant,

I am doing fine. This product has been there since 2002 and I have received various reports by talking to users about this. Some have actually experienced drop in speed. Many say it works fine. But what I gathered from people who are very well respected in the security industry is that this is just a router with SPI and NAT (for selective packet filtering and port forwarding), *BUT* where users cannot change the firmwire settings at will, *and* another level of firmwire backup so that it is set back to factory settings if changed by malicious software (ya it has software, unlike what was thought previously). Product is okay , but costly.
I would suggest a *wired* router from linksys (available at all major cities in India or ordered online) with SPI and NAT (latter included by default) will do the job fine. Alphashield is great tool for users who are not comfortable in tweaking with the firmwire/settings etc. Otherwise it is as bad or good as any hardware FW.

And yes, whether you have AS or Router, its better to keep a lightweight FW like OnlineArmour *free* with HIPS enabled, cos you never know when the router can be breached!
